[發(fā)明專利]公有云網(wǎng)絡(luò)的內(nèi)網(wǎng)負載均衡實現(xiàn)方法在審
| 申請?zhí)枺?/td> | 202010573104.7 | 申請日: | 2020-06-22 |
| 公開(公告)號: | CN111756830A | 公開(公告)日: | 2020-10-09 |
| 發(fā)明(設(shè)計)人: | 胡章豐;任秋崢;張信杰;李彥君 | 申請(專利權(quán))人: | 浪潮云信息技術(shù)股份公司 |
| 主分類號: | H04L29/08 | 分類號: | H04L29/08;H04L29/12;H04L12/803 |
| 代理公司: | 濟南信達專利事務(wù)所有限公司 37100 | 代理人: | 馮春連 |
| 地址: | 250100 山東省濟南市高*** | 國省代碼: | 山東;37 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 公有 網(wǎng)絡(luò) 負載 均衡 實現(xiàn) 方法 | ||
1.一種公有云網(wǎng)絡(luò)的內(nèi)網(wǎng)負載均衡實現(xiàn)方法,其特征在于,基于LVS和分布式等價路由,該實現(xiàn)方法需要:
1)、在租戶VPC內(nèi)部部署多個負載均衡實例虛機;
2)、將負載均衡服務(wù)的VIP地址配置在多個負載均衡實例虛機的環(huán)回口上,有多個負載均衡服務(wù)就配置多個VIP地址;
3)、關(guān)閉負載均衡虛機的ARP跨接口代答;
4)、在租戶VPC的虛擬路由器上配置到達各個VIP地址的ECMP等價路由,給每個VIP指定多個下一跳;
5)、在VPC的虛擬路由器上開啟ARP代理功能和ARP的同網(wǎng)絡(luò)代理功能,將到達VIP的流量吸引到虛擬路由器上來,由虛擬路由器根據(jù)VIP地址的ECMP等價路由進行ECMP負載均衡,將流量分發(fā)到各個負載均衡實例虛機上,然后再由各個負載均衡實例虛機根據(jù)具體負載均衡算法進行二次負載均衡分發(fā),將服務(wù)請求送到具體的后端RS服務(wù)器,由后端RS服務(wù)器提供具體的服務(wù)。
2.根據(jù)權(quán)利要求1所述的公有云網(wǎng)絡(luò)的內(nèi)網(wǎng)負載均衡實現(xiàn)方法,其特征在于,執(zhí)行4)的過程中,給每個VIP指定多個下一跳時,VIP配置在幾個負載均衡實例虛機就指定幾個下一跳。
3.根據(jù)權(quán)利要求1所述的公有云網(wǎng)絡(luò)的內(nèi)網(wǎng)負載均衡實現(xiàn)方法,其特征在于,內(nèi)網(wǎng)負載均衡的客戶端、負載均衡實例、服務(wù)端均位于VPC內(nèi)部,即位于同一個二層域下。
4.根據(jù)權(quán)利要求1所述的公有云網(wǎng)絡(luò)的內(nèi)網(wǎng)負載均衡實現(xiàn)方法,其特征在于,該實現(xiàn)方法的實現(xiàn)架構(gòu)包括北向rest接口層、負載均衡服務(wù)層、負載均衡集群和VPC虛擬路由器四個層次,其中,北向rest接口層為上層云管平臺或第三方平臺提供restful的接口,并用于管理和操作內(nèi)網(wǎng)負載均衡的各種資源。
5.根據(jù)權(quán)利要求4所述的公有云網(wǎng)絡(luò)的內(nèi)網(wǎng)負載均衡實現(xiàn)方法,其特征在于,負載均衡服務(wù)層包括負載均衡實例管理組件、負載均衡配置管理組件、負載均衡數(shù)據(jù)庫、負載均衡實例監(jiān)控組件、RS服務(wù)器監(jiān)控組件、ECMP管理組件;
負載均衡實例管理組件負責VPC內(nèi)負載均衡實例虛機的創(chuàng)建、刪除、動態(tài)擴容或收縮;
負載均衡配置管理組件負責根據(jù)rest接口下發(fā)的配置進行配置下發(fā),將具體的負載均衡配置需求下發(fā)到負載均衡實例虛機上,由實例虛機上的負載均衡代理進行具體的配置變更;
負載均衡數(shù)據(jù)庫負責存儲用戶的負載均衡配置信息;
負載均衡實例監(jiān)控組件負責監(jiān)控負載均衡實例虛機的存活狀態(tài),當發(fā)現(xiàn)負載均衡實例虛機故障時需通知負載均衡實例管理組件重新調(diào)度創(chuàng)建一個負載均衡實例虛機,并將故障實例虛機上的負載均衡配置信息遷移到新的負載均衡實例虛機上;
RS服務(wù)器監(jiān)控組件負責監(jiān)控后端RS服務(wù)器的存活狀態(tài),當發(fā)現(xiàn)RS服務(wù)器故障或服務(wù)不可達時,需通知負載均衡配置管理組件修改與該故障RS服務(wù)器相關(guān)的負載均衡配置信息;
ECMP管理組件負責根據(jù)負載均衡的配置信息對VPC的虛擬路由器下發(fā)ECMP的VIP主機路由信息,并開啟虛擬路由器上的ARP跨接口代答功能。
6.根據(jù)權(quán)利要求5所述的公有云網(wǎng)絡(luò)的內(nèi)網(wǎng)負載均衡實現(xiàn)方法,其特征在于,基于四層實現(xiàn)架構(gòu),內(nèi)網(wǎng)負載均衡的具體執(zhí)行流程包括:
步驟1、用戶通過公有云控制臺或OpenAPI接口創(chuàng)建負載均衡實例;
步驟2、上述創(chuàng)建請求最終會調(diào)用北向rest接口層的restful接口來真正創(chuàng)建負載均衡實例,并傳遞給負載均衡服務(wù)層;
步驟3、負載均衡服務(wù)器層判斷當前VPC內(nèi)的負載均衡實例虛機是否還有足夠資源承載當前用戶的負載均衡實例,若不夠,則觸發(fā)負載均衡實例管理組件動態(tài)擴張一臺或多臺負載均衡實例虛機;
步驟4、當用戶調(diào)用restful接口創(chuàng)建一個負載均衡服務(wù)時,負載均衡配置管理組件將配置信息錄入負載均衡數(shù)據(jù)庫,此外,負載均衡配置管理組件還將負載均衡監(jiān)聽器的配置信息下發(fā)到具體的負載均衡實例虛機上,負載均衡實例虛機上的負載均衡代理完成負載均衡監(jiān)聽配置信息的下發(fā)和生效;
步驟5、ECMP管理組件將VIP的ECMP等價路由下發(fā)到VPC虛擬路由器上,每個VIP位于幾個負載均衡實例虛機上就配置幾個下一跳。
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于浪潮云信息技術(shù)股份公司,未經(jīng)浪潮云信息技術(shù)股份公司許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202010573104.7/1.html,轉(zhuǎn)載請聲明來源鉆瓜專利網(wǎng)。
- 網(wǎng)絡(luò)和網(wǎng)絡(luò)終端
- 網(wǎng)絡(luò)DNA
- 網(wǎng)絡(luò)地址自適應(yīng)系統(tǒng)和方法及應(yīng)用系統(tǒng)和方法
- 網(wǎng)絡(luò)系統(tǒng)及網(wǎng)絡(luò)至網(wǎng)絡(luò)橋接器
- 一種電力線網(wǎng)絡(luò)中根節(jié)點網(wǎng)絡(luò)協(xié)調(diào)方法和系統(tǒng)
- 一種多網(wǎng)絡(luò)定位方法、存儲介質(zhì)及移動終端
- 網(wǎng)絡(luò)裝置、網(wǎng)絡(luò)系統(tǒng)、網(wǎng)絡(luò)方法以及網(wǎng)絡(luò)程序
- 從重復(fù)網(wǎng)絡(luò)地址自動恢復(fù)的方法、網(wǎng)絡(luò)設(shè)備及其存儲介質(zhì)
- 神經(jīng)網(wǎng)絡(luò)的訓(xùn)練方法、裝置及存儲介質(zhì)
- 網(wǎng)絡(luò)管理方法和裝置





